Josh Brown says he's not sure if Nike can ever turn it around

CNBC PRO contributor Josh Brown of Ritholtz Wealth Management suggests Nike is not positioning itself for a successful turnaround, citing aging celebrity endorsements, increasing competition, and a 19% stock decline this year following a 30% loss in 2024. Nike's late March guidance indicated sales declines in the fiscal fourth quarter at the "low end" of the "mid-teens range," worse than anticipated, despite beating Wall Street expectations in its fiscal third quarter; the company also plans to raise prices amidst restructuring, tariffs, and sliding consumer confidence. While Nike relies on staple sneakers, competitors are forcing them to fight defensively in key markets.

Nike (NKE) faces significant challenges in executing a successful turnaround, according to Josh Brown of Ritholtz Wealth Management, who notes concerns over its aging celebrity spokespeople, such as LeBron James and Michael Jordan, and intensifying competition. The company's stock reflects these headwinds, having fallen 19% year-to-date after a 30% loss in 2024, and is described as a 'falling knife' currently trading near an eight-year low. This underperformance persists even when Nike surpasses Wall Street's quarterly expectations, as seen in its fiscal third quarter, after which the stock, according to Brown, typically continues its downward trend within a week. Compounding these issues, Nike's guidance for its fiscal fourth quarter anticipates a sales decline at the 'low end' of the 'mid-teens range'—considerably worse than analysts expected—citing ongoing restructuring, potential tariff impacts, and sliding consumer confidence. While the company intends to raise prices and continues to leverage staple products like Air Force Ones and Jordans, Brown suggests these strategies may be insufficient to counter defensive pressures from newer brands in key markets such as running.
